Internal concerns like burst pipes and also overflows can result in emergency flooding. Maintain on reviewing to find out what you can when dealing with emergency situation flooding.
1. Switch Off Main Water Valve
Pipelines can rupture because of freezing temperatures, high pressure, clog, water heater concerns, as well as other elements. Despite the cause, you need to act rapidly to guarantee porous house materials, devices, and also home furnishings do not absorb the water, causing damage. Turn off the primary valve prior to you do any cleaning to guarantee water stops gathering. Killing the water source is easy, and it is something you can do on your own. When it comes to the ruptured pipeline, ask for emergency situation plumbing solutions to repair it right away.
2. Shut down the Breaker
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electric outlets, it can create injuries or casualties. Maintain the power off up until excess water is gone.
3. Move Necessary Damp Times
When it pertains to conserving your furnishings and also devices, time is essential. For this reason, you must relocate whatever sharpen valuables you can from the affected location to a dry place. This hinders further damage since the longer they take in water, the extra comprehensive the problem.
4. Paper the Extent of Damages
Make note of all the damage caused by the burst pipe. You can document notes, take pictures, as well as accumulate video clips. This is a terrific method to give evidence to gather insurance claims on your residence insurance policy protection. With documentation, you can also get a clear picture of the extent of the damage.
5. Eliminate Water ASAP
You should eliminate excess water as soon as possible. Should there be a large quantity of standing water, you may need a water pump for removal. You can rent this tools if you do not have one. If it's late at night, the convention pail technique likewise functions. Use a number of pails as well as manual work to take it out. When very little water is left, you can take in the rest with old shirts or towels. You may likewise require to get rid of damaged materials like rugs and also rugs.
6. Dry the Location
Focus on drying the affected locations. If the climate is positive, open doors and windows to raise air movement. You can likewise set up electric followers and put them in the strongest setup. A dehumidifier additionally works in securing moisture to prevent mold as well as molds.
7. Collaborate with Experts
When you suffer substantial water damage because of emergency flooding from a ruptured pipeline, you can work with a reconstruction professional to reconstruct as well as restore your residence. Most of all, don't fail to remember to call a respectable plumber to repair the burst pipe as well as inspect the rest of your piping system. Otherwise, all your clean-up will certainly be provided pointless.

Making It Through the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ations
If you stay in a storm-prone area, you should be made use of by now on what to do, where to go and what to need to be prepared for negative weather condition. If you're not made use of to obtaining mauled by high winds and hard rain, you most likely don't have an concept exactly how finest to deal with a tornado situation.
For starters, tornados do not simply come without a caution. Weather stations monitor the ambience all the time. If a tornado is feasible, they will certainly release 2 kinds of warnings:
Storm watch-- is issued when there is a feasible tornado in your area. You probably will be experiencing a dark, cloudy skies, an abnormally windy day and also some rainfall. The storm might or may not come, yet this is the moment to maintain tuned to your local radio for information and updates.
Storm warning-- is issued when a storm is headed towards your area. Attempt to stay indoors as long as possible. Or if citizens are advised to evacuate to a more secure place, go as early as you can. Don't wait till the last minute to leave your home. By that time, the streets could be swamped as well as website traffic is bad. You don't intend to be caught in your automobile in bad weather condition.

Points do not constantly go negative throughout tornados, yet weather condition is uncertain as well as anything can take place. To help you prepare for a storm emergency, right here are a few suggestions:
Dress up.
Wear enough garments to maintain on your own cozy. Warm may not be available in your house so obtain extra layers and also coverings to preserve your body temperature completely.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and boots all set too.
Have food prepared.
Emergency stipulations are a should throughout storm emergencies. See to it you stock on no-cook food, tinned food, some candy and also other non-perishable products. And don't neglect can openers, scissors or utensils. If the tornado obtains too bad as well as the streets are swamped, you will have a problem heading out to the grocery store shops. Besides, shops might be closed.
Maintain containers of water convenient. Tidy water might be difficult to find by during really bad problems and also the most awful thing you can do is struggle with dehydration since you were not prepared. Keep a supply of at the very least one gallon for every single individual each day that will last for 3 to 4 days.
Fill the bathtub.
You'll need extra water for cleaning and purging the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best fill your bath tub, water containers and also containers with water. If you have kids in the house, take preventative measures by covering deep containers and keeping youngsters away from the bathroom unless necessary.
Emergency package
Have a clinical or very first kit prepared as well as make sure it's freshly-stocked. It ought to contain an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ton rounds, Q-tips, medicated plasters and required medications. It's also a great concept to have another package in your car.
If anyone in your family is under unique drug, ensure you have adequate products to last until after the storm is over and drug shops are open.
Lights off
Anticipate power interruptions during storm emergency situations. You will not have any type of electrical power, so supply on candle lights, flashlights and emergency situation lights. Have additional fresh batteries and suits in case you run out.
If you can not switch on the television,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a terminal that covers your area. Media will certainly monitor the storm and also will maintain you updated.
You may require hot water during the duration when power is not yet available, so keep a tiny tank of gas about just in case. Your outdoor barbecue grill will certainly do nicely.
Get an alternating sanctuary.
If you believe your home will certainly suffer substantially, it's a good suggestion to take into consideration an alternating sanctuary. It could be an discharge facility or another home or building that is safer. Make sure you have enough gas in your tank in case you require to leave your home as well as relocation someplace. Keep to a greater ground where you have much better possibilities of being safe and also completely dry.
